		<description>Economic terrorism;&lt;blockquote&gt;&lt;a href=&quot;http://www.telegraph.co.uk/finance/globalbusiness/3170738/Libya-will-pull-assets-stop-oil-supply-to-Switzwerland.html&quot; rel=&quot;nofollow&quot;&gt;Kaddafi torpedoes EU economy&lt;/a&gt;

&lt;strong&gt;Libya will take $7bn of assets out of Swiss banks and stop supplying oil to the country&lt;/strong&gt;, as an acrimonious dispute that started with &lt;a href=&quot;http://news.bbc.co.uk/2/hi/africa/7512925.stm&quot; rel=&quot;nofollow&quot;&gt;the arrest of Colonel Gaddafi&#039;s son&lt;/a&gt; escalated.

The north African country said the moves were a protest against the &quot;poor treatement of Libyan diplomats and businessmen by the canton of Geneva&quot;, according to state news agency Jana.

Libya first threatened to stop oil deliveries after &lt;a href=&quot;http://news.bbc.co.uk/2/hi/africa/7512925.stm&quot; rel=&quot;nofollow&quot;&gt;Mr Gaddafi&#039;s son Hannibal was arrested in Switzerland in July&lt;/a&gt;. Two servants claimed they had been assaulted by Hannibal and his wife Aline. Libya didn&#039;t go through with the threat and Swiss prosecutors closed the case last month, after the servants received compensation from the couple and dropped the charges.

Libya said it would revoke the latest decision to stop oil deliveries once it had an explanation about the way its diplomats and businessmen had been treated, and sought a formal apology from the Swiss government.

&lt;strong&gt;The country supplies about 20pc of Switzerland&#039;s oil&lt;/strong&gt;, but Swiss oil officials said the cut-off would not hurt availability or push up prices because the country would have time to find an alternative supplier.

Libya&#039;s national oil company, Tamoil, said the decision to stop supplies had been taken by the government and did not know how long the suspension would last.

&lt;strong&gt;The Swiss stock market opened sharply lower&lt;/strong&gt;, falling 6pc to 5461 points. Insurance shares were hard hit with Swiss Life falling 12pc , Zurich Financial and Swiss Reinsurance falling 8pc, 8pc and 12pc respectively. Credit Suisse fell 10pc.&lt;/blockquote&gt;/&lt;em&gt;mercurial.. yet &quot;&lt;a href=&quot;http://www.usatoday.com/news/world/2008-09-08-rice-gadhafi_N.htm&quot; rel=&quot;nofollow&quot;&gt;rehabilitated&lt;/a&gt;&quot;&lt;/em&gt;</description>

USD started gaining against every other major currency (except yen, and there&#039;s a reason for that) around July 15 - the same time oil  peaked (gold made a second peak as well, and iirc this is also when other commodities started to slide).  Russia invaded Georgia on August 8.

As for the yen, on the foreign exchange market that&#039;s the carry trade currency - borrow at a low interest rate (sell yen), invest in a high interest rate (buy euro, pound, etc.), take the difference.  If you look at the yen pairs (USD/JPY, EUR/JPY, GBP/JPY, AUD/JPY, etc.) you&#039;ll notice they&#039;ve all, more or less, fallen off a cliff - people are buying yen and selling everything else (&quot;unwinding&quot; their carry trades).  It&#039;s risk aversion.  There&#039;s no reason, at least regarding fundamentals, that one would buy yen (Japan having almost no raw materials of its own, an increasingly sluggish economy everywhere it exports to, its deteriorating demographics, etc.).

So, we have obvious risk aversion going on.  It isn&#039;t that investors have confidence in the U.S. economy necessarily, it&#039;s more likely they have less confidence in other economies.</description>
